I am not getting the "save as" prompt in internet explorer after installing
service pack 2 for xp. i have checked the confirm open after download and
automatic download options and both are set correctly. it looks like other
people are having the same problem in the forum but i have not came across an
anser that will work. One file i am having problems with is a csv file. It
automaticlly opens with excel inside of an internet explorer window when
clicked.

the right click option does not work in the scenario. the file is built
dynamiclly using the options you enter on a website form. you have date
options that let you select a beginning date and ending date. once you click
submit the file is produced a send back to you. before sp2 IE would prompt
you asking you to save or open. after sp2 it automaticlly opens in excel.
